What this job involves:

As the Engineer of electromechanical/utility services, your responsibilities include overseeing maintenance tasks, coordinating with stakeholders, implementing preventive maintenance plans, conducting inspections, and reviewing subordinate work. You will also be responsible for documentation, training staff, budgeting, monitoring SLAs/KPIs, managing invoices and vendors, and ensuring safety compliance. Additionally, you will create action plans, participate in evacuation drills, maintain reports, and implement checklists for daily operations. Overall, your focus will be on delivering efficient and reliable services while prioritizing safety and customer satisfaction.

What your day-to-day will look like:

  • Manage the MEP scope of the projects to ensure the quality and deliverables within the stipulated time.
  • Manage and maintain electromechanical/utility services at the site, coordinating with technicians and ensuring timely task completion.
  • Implement planned preventive maintenance (PPM) and conduct regular inspections to identify and address risk areas.
  • Ensure smooth operations of all Mechanical, Electrical, plumbing installations and Civil works in the facility
  • Responsible for carrying out all maintenance-related schedules and shutdowns in consultation with superiors/clients.
  • Support the engineering team to maintain the budgets for Engineering & Operational contracts.
  • Responsible to handle the shifts independently on all Engineering related matters;
  • Responsible for daily reporting on MEP to the Engineer;
  • Assist in providing comprehensive facility, contract and procurement management for technical services to the client.
  • Implement and oversee the pre-emptive maintenance program to reduce the risk of sudden failures of critical equipment;
  • Maintain the logbooks, checklists and Plan Preventive Maintenance schedules for all MEP installations;
  • Ensure the contractors follow the house rules, Safety & others at all times and the projects are handled with minimum inconvenience to the Client;
  • Take rounds of the facility regularly to identify issues and support events at the site.
  • Review the work of subordinate staff, provide guidance, and facilitate their training and development.
  • Oversee vendor quotations and invoices, schedule monthly vendor meetings, and take corrective actions when necessary.
  • Conduct risk assessments, create action plans, and participate in evacuation drills for emergency preparedness.
  • Maintain engineering reports, enforce safety practices, and monitor daily/weekly/monthly checklists to ensure efficient service delivery and adherence to safety standards.

Desired or preferred experience and technical skills:

  • Minimum 5 years of experience in residential/Commercial engineering management.
  • Having a degree in Electrical/Mechanical/Electronic Engineering or a related field
  • Strong experience managing and maintaining electromechanical/utility services in a commercial or industrial setting.
  • Knowledge of preventive maintenance strategies and ability to implement planned preventive maintenance (PPM) schedules effectively.
  • Experience in conducting inspections to identify risks and defects and taking necessary corrective actions.
  • Demonstrated ability to review and guide subordinate staff, providing technical guidance and support as needed.
  • Proficient in documentation and tracking, including managing AMCs, invoices, and vendor quotations.
  • Strong budgeting and financial management skills, with the ability to monitor SLAs/KPIs and control expenses.
  • Excellent understanding of safety regulations and ability to enforce safe working practices, conduct risk assessments, and create action plans for emergency response and system failures.
